Visualizzazione dei risultati da 1 a 8 su 8

Discussione: Cambiare immagine

  1. #1

    Cambiare immagine

    è possibile creare dei rollover che cambino l'immagine al centro della pagina quando ci si passa sopra?

  2. #2

  3. #3
    nella head metti questo

    <script language=""JavaScript"">
    <!--
    function cambia(ImageName,ImageFile){
    ImageName.src = ImageFile;
    }
    // -->
    </script>


    e il link lo crei così

    <a href="pagina.html"
    onMouseOver="cambia(img_c1,'img2.jpg')"
    onMouseOut="cambia(img_c1,'img1.jpg')">
    [img]img1.jpg[/img]
    </a>



    L'intuizione creativa più di ogni altra cosa è l'unico elemento per cui la vita vale la pena di essere vissuta (D.W)

  4. #4
    Originariamente inviato da Stanislao
    nella head metti questo

    <script language=""JavaScript"">
    <!--
    function cambia(ImageName,ImageFile){
    ImageName.src = ImageFile;
    }
    // -->
    </script>


    e il link lo crei così

    <a href="pagina.html"
    onMouseOver="cambia(img_c1,'img2.jpg')"
    onMouseOut="cambia(img_c1,'img1.jpg')">
    [img]img1.jpg[/img]
    </a>




    scusa ma non capisco il funzionamento....

    passando sopra immagine1 , l'immagine2 posta al centro dello schermo deve cambiare in immagine3... come farE?

  5. #5

  6. #6
    Ieri non sono passato da casa, ma stasera recupero il codice. Non mi ricordo come si fa, ma l'avevo fatto in 2 modi (2-3 anni fa). Il primo passando sopra con il mouse al thumbnail, l'altro solo quando si clicca.

  7. #7
    Utente di HTML.it L'avatar di zoom
    Registrato dal
    Dec 2001
    Messaggi
    1,737
    buttato giù in due minuti...
    prova a vedere se funziona e se può andare..

    [img][/img]
    [img][/img]

    script:

    codice:
    		function cambia(id,percorso){
    			if (document.getElementById){
    				document.getElementById(id).src=percorso;
    			}
    			else{
    				if(document.layers){
    					document.layers[id].src=percorso;
    				}
    				else if(document.all){
    					eval("document.all." + id + ".src=" + percorso);
    				}
    			}
    		}
    Chicco Ravaglia per sempre con noi!

  8. #8
    Originariamente inviato da Varvez Reloaded
    scusa ma non capisco il funzionamento....

    passando sopra immagine1 , l'immagine2 posta al centro dello schermo deve cambiare in immagine3... come farE?
    La soluzione è già in quello script

    Guarda, i parametri che passi alla funzione sono 2:
    1) Il nome del tag (contenitore) dell'immagine
    2) Il nome dell'immagine da caricare.

    non dovresti far altro che dire a quale tag cambiare immagine

    Es.
    <a href="pagina.html"
    onMouseOver="cambia(img_c2,'img2.jpg')"
    onMouseOut="cambia(img_c1,'img1.jpg')">
    [img]img1.jpg[/img]
    </a>
    La più grande forza a disposizione dell'umanità è la non violenza (Ghandi).
    (15/06/2003 - 16 points, 17 rembounds and 1 standing ovation x Admiral David Robinson ... San Antonio Spurs~ 2003/5 NBA champions)

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.